Giant Quilted Bow Class


We will be constructing the bow in class, you will need to prepare your fabric pieces in advance according to the instructions on the pattern.

The pattern provides two options.

  •          Wholecloth – using the instructions in the pattern, cut your fabric and quilt (simple lines/grid looks fabulous)
  •          Patchwork – using the the instructions in the pattern, piece your squares and quilt (simple lines/grid looks fabulous)

They recommend quilting both options with high loft poly batting. I have tried several different options, you will find the one that works best for you. I prefer using Soft and Stable as it gives the bow a bit of stiffness. If using Soft and stable, you will not need to quilt the back side of the fabric.

We will trim your quilted fabric/patchwork in class and construct your bow.

What to bring to class:

  1.       Sewing machine and basic sewing supplies
  2.       Matching thread
  3.       Turning tool (skewer, dowel, etc.)
  4.       Rotary cutter and scissors
  5.       Marking pen or chalk to mark bow ends
  6.       Ruler to trim bow pieces (at least 12”)
  7.       Iron and ironing surface (there will be an iron available for use for the class)
  8.       If you have 8” or longer zip ties bring 2 (we will have some available if you don’t have any on hand)
  9.       Sew in Velcro (you only need about 1” (we will have some available if you don’t have any on hand)
